ITV Announces Key U.S. Series Acquisition

[via press release from ABC]

ITV ANNOUNCES KEY U.S. SERIES ACQUISITION

ITV has announced an exclusive UK deal with Buena Vista International Television (BVITV) for the licensing of �Six Degrees,� a new drama from J.J. Abrams, creator of �Lost,� to air on its flagship channels ITV1 and 2, making it the first U.S. series to be aired in primetime on ITV1 in nine years.

�Six Degrees� follows New Yorkers from all walks of life, whose lives unexpectedly become intertwined. The show will air in the U.S. on the ABC Television Network this fall in primetime, immediately following the highly successful network drama, �Grey�s Anatomy.�

The plot explores the fact that anyone on the planet can be connected to any other person through a chain of six people, which means that no one is a stranger... for long. In this hour-long drama, six New Yorkers go about their lives without realizing the impact they�re having on one another. A mysterious web of coincidences will gradually draw these strangers closer, changing the course of their lives forever. Is it fate? Is there a greater force at work? What is guiding us along and connecting our lives?

This intriguing tale of intertwined destinies reminds us that romance, success, peace or forgiveness might be right around the corner, but they can also be lost in an instant. It�s a story that underlines just how small the world really is, and how someone just five meters away might be shaping our future right now.

�Six Degrees� stars Jay Hernandez (�Friday Night Lights�), Erika Christensen (�Flightplan�), Bridget Moynahan (�Sex and the City�), Dorian Missick (�Lucky Number Slevin�), Hope Davis (�About Schmidt�) and Campbell Scott (�The Secret Lives of Dentists�). Its executive producers are J.J. Abrams and Bryan Burk (�Lost,� �Alias�), Stuart Zicherman and Raven Metzner (�Elektra�), and it is produced by Touchstone Television.

Jay Kandola, director of Acquisitions for ITV, said: �My aim was to get brand-defining shows for the ITV Network. I am delighted that �Six Degrees� will be a contemporary exciting new addition to the ITV1 and ITV2 offering.�

Tom Toumazis, executive vice president and managing director, BVITV EMEA, said: �As U.S. series continue to return to primetime around the world, we are delighted to be working with ITV to launch �Six Degrees� in primetime on ITV1. We are sure that the series� production pedigree and strong cast will appeal strongly to a UK audience.�

The agreement was closed by Jay Kandola (director of Acquisitions, ITV) and BVITV�s Catherine Powell, executive director, Sales, UK & Ireland.
